Technical screening questions 1) Check if two strings are anagrams 2) resume walk through ( Like diff between hibernate and jpa) 3) questions on log4j 4) Was given a sample code for finiding prime numbers between 1 to n . IT was technically right but was asked to follow best coding practices and improve it like java docs, comments, variable naming etc Virtual onsite Interview Round 1 question 1) What is singleton design pattern. 2) Have you used microservices before ? Please explain from you work experience. Coding question : I was given some boiler plate code. I was asked to design Object oriented design of twitter. Like 1) Posting tweets 2) Following users 3) Unfollowing users. 4) Generating timeline. These were the 4 methods they asked me to write code for. I have used Maps to do this. You do not need to use any databases or tables. You can use any inmemory data structures and get this done. Round -2 1) I was asked to construct a binary search tree from a given list of Integers. 2) I was asked how would i implement this for an List of objects and are needed to be sorted based on a field in an object.( This can be done with generics) 3) I was also asked to use compareTo() to achieve this. Third round 1) I was asked to write code to print a pascal triangle in console 1 1 1 1 2 1 1 3 3 1 1 4 6 4 1 1 5 10 10 5 1 etc Round 4: Situational and behavioral questions were asked.

The questions depend on which project they give you, but for me this included: building a stats page (full stack), building a feature to detect if email forwarding is properly set up, and writing some new email data to the database to include it when a candidate responds to an email alias.
